    Xiaomi’s T and Redmi K Series Making A Comeback In India: Here Are Expected Models

    Xiaomi is gearing up to launch its next-gen T-series phones – the Xiaomi 17T and 17T Pro. With this, Xiaomi might finally bring the T-series back to India after nearly four years.

    As of now, there is no official confirmation regarding this; reports suggest Xiaomi 17T could make its way to the country, as it has already been spotted in the IMEI database. In addition to Xiaomi’s T series, Redmi K series phones are reportedly arriving in India.

    Tipster Abhishek Yadav says in its latest post that ”Xiaomi’s T series and Redmi K series will make a comeback in India.” The Indian variant of the Xiaomi 17T has appeared on the IMEI database with model number 2602DPT53I.

    For the unaware, the Redmi K series phone comes to the global market with POCO branding. It remains to be seen if Redmi has the same plan or changes the plans. Redmi just launched the K90 series, so we expect the K90 series may arrive soon.

    Xiaomi T-Series May Finally Arriving to India

    According to the IMEI database, there are two versions of the Xiaomi 17T: one labelled for the global market and another with an Indian variant code. Given that, there is a chance the brand will now only bring the standard model. As far as launch is concerned, reports suggest that Xiaomi could unveil the 17T series in February 2026 – a major shift from the usual September timeline followed by its predecessor, the Xiaomi 15T series.
